SMI is predictor of cardiac events in diabetics with cardiovascular risk factors



March 6th, 2006

In asymptomatic diabetic patients with additional cardiovascular risk factors, silent myocardial ischemia is a predictor of cardiac events.

According to recent research from France, "Silent myocardial ischemia (SMI) in asymptomatic subjects with no history of myocardial infarction or angina is a frequent condition in diabetic patients. The aim of the study was to examine the predictive value of SMI for cardiac events in a multicenter cohort and to determine whether this value is higher in patients with a particular clinical profile."
